Saudi Industrial Export Co.'s (SIECO) board of directors, on March 7, 2021, gave the go-ahead for closing the company's branch in Jordan, the firm said in a filing to Tadawul.
The move is part of the board's efforts to achieve continuous development and push the company towards profitability.
The firm attributed the branch closure to weak financial performance and to reduce general and administrative expenses.
The relevant financial impact, if any, will be disclosed by the end of 2021, the statement noted.
In March 2020, SIECO announced the start of its branch in Amman Duty Free, after registering it in December 2017, according to data available with Argaam.
